#Validate input date is in desired format. TestDate.java
import java.text.SimpleDateFormat;
import java.util.Date;
public class TestDate {
public static void main(String[] args) throws Exception {
SimpleDateFormat sdf = new SimpleDateFormat("MM-dd-YYYY");
Date date = sdf.parse("12-29-0010") ;
System.out.println(date);
System.out.println(sdf.format(date)); //Can compare both strings to see if they are same that means format is correct else not.
}
}